Capacity Building training for Corruption Prevention Committees and integrity Assurance Officers

The College of Health Sciences (CHS) held a Capacity Building training for Corruption Prevention Committees and Integrity Assurance Officers on Monday, 8th April, 2019.

The workshop which was organized by the University of Nairobi in liason with the Ethics and Anti-Corruption Commission (EACC) was held in the School of Medicine Boardroom.

The event was graced by Prof. Stephen Kiama, the acting DVC Human Resource and Administration.

Taming the Tyranny of the Barons: Administrative Law and the Regulation of Power

Professor Migai Akech's inaugural lecture titled "Taming the Tyranny of the Barons: Administrative Law and the Regulation of Power" delved into a fundamental concern that has animated him since childhood: the routine and aggravating displays of power abuses that permeate our daily lives, both in private and public realms. From arbitrariness and condescension to corruption and violence, these manifestations of tyranny erode the very liberties and livelihoods we seek to protect through our societal institutions.
